The Client Services Web Team, within Governors Technology Office, is recruiting a full stack developer, to be located in our Carson City, NV office, to support over 100 state agency public facing websites. The team assists other state agencies in creating and modifying websites via a content management system. Incumbents will use industry standard tools and languages to create new CMS features to enhance State of Nevada websites. As an Information Technology Professional, incumbents analyze, develop, implement, maintain, and modify In-House, Vendor Created and For Purchase (COTS) applications. Incumbents perform journey level application developer duties including full SDLC processes, maintenance, and application enhancements. Incumbents will perform all duties in conformance to the GTO Division’s application development standards. The following platforms and languages are used by the Web Team: .NET, C#, HTML, JavaScript, CSS, Ubuntu, php, and MSSQL.
